Top 7 Python Frameworks for AI Agents

by Nia Walker
3 minutes read

In the ever-evolving landscape of artificial intelligence, Python continues to stand out as a top choice for developers looking to design, test, and deploy AI agents swiftly and effectively. With a multitude of frameworks available, selecting the right one can make all the difference in streamlining the process of creating multi-agent systems. Today, we’ll delve into the top seven Python frameworks tailor-made for AI agents, each offering unique features and functionalities to expedite development tasks.

  • TensorFlow:

Description: TensorFlow is a widely-used open-source framework for machine learning and artificial intelligence applications.

Benefits: Known for its flexibility and scalability, TensorFlow allows developers to build and train AI models efficiently.

Use Case: Ideal for creating AI agents that require complex computations and large-scale data processing.

  • PyTorch:

Description: PyTorch is another popular open-source machine learning framework that offers dynamic computational graphs.

Benefits: With a focus on simplicity and flexibility, PyTorch enables developers to experiment and iterate quickly.

Use Case: Well-suited for rapid prototyping of AI agents and models that require frequent adjustments.

  • Keras:

Description: Keras is a high-level neural networks API that runs on top of TensorFlow, Theano, or CNTK.

Benefits: Known for its user-friendly interface and ease of use, Keras simplifies the creation of deep learning models.

Use Case: Great for developers looking to build AI agents with minimal code and maximum efficiency.

  • Scikit-learn:

Description: Scikit-learn is a simple and efficient tool for data mining and data analysis.

Benefits: With a focus on usability and accessibility, Scikit-learn provides a wide range of algorithms and tools.

Use Case: Perfect for developers working on AI agents that require traditional machine learning techniques.

  • OpenAI Gym:

Description: OpenAI Gym is a toolkit for developing and comparing reinforcement learning algorithms.

Benefits: Offers a diverse set of environments to test and train AI agents, making it a valuable tool for reinforcement learning tasks.

Use Case: Ideal for developers focusing on building AI agents that learn through interaction and rewards.

  • Theano:

Description: Theano is a numerical computation library designed for evaluating mathematical expressions.

Benefits: Known for its speed and efficiency, Theano is often used in conjunction with other deep learning frameworks.

Use Case: Suitable for developers working on AI agents that require fast and reliable numeric computations.

  • Gym Retro:

Description: Gym Retro is an environment for training AI agents on classic video games.

Benefits: Provides a nostalgic yet challenging setting for testing AI agent capabilities and performance.

Use Case: Perfect for developers looking to benchmark their AI agents against established gaming benchmarks.
